
晨鐘初響,打開tpwallet卻見余額為零——這不僅是用戶恐慌點,更是系統(tǒng)工程的排查起點。本手冊以工程師思路逐步剖析原因、列出流程與防護建議,適用于支付服務(wù)與數(shù)字化錢包運維。
1) 初步判斷(5分鐘):確認用戶地址/賬戶是否一致、檢查本地緩存與前端幣種換算、測試網(wǎng)絡(luò)連通性(RPC/REST返回碼)、核對是否處于測試網(wǎng)或主網(wǎng)差異。檢查最近交易是否處于pending或nonce沖突導(dǎo)致未上鏈。
2) 深度診斷(30–120分鐘):讀取鏈上余額并比對后端賬本;查看后端入賬流水、消息隊列消費狀態(tài)與重試計數(shù);核查派生路徑/HD錢包索引是否錯位;分析API網(wǎng)關(guān)、認證失敗與速率限制日志;若為托管錢包,審計熱錢包轉(zhuǎn)賬流水與冷錢包對賬記錄。
3) 系統(tǒng)根因(架構(gòu)角度):常見于緩存不一致、事件驅(qū)動補賬延遲、微服務(wù)異步失敗、數(shù)據(jù)庫主從延遲或分布式事務(wù)回滾。前端顯示為零有時是幣種精度/匯率換算錯誤或合約代幣未正確解析。
4) 安全與數(shù)據(jù)保護:密鑰管理應(yīng)使用KMS/HSM或MPC實現(xiàn)多方簽名;傳輸層使用強加密與短期憑證;敏感日志脫敏并落審計鏈;權(quán)限細化到最小化訪問。
5) 恢復(fù)與預(yù)防流程(Runbook):A. 立即開啟只讀模式并通知用戶;B. 回溯鏈上與賬本,執(zhí)行補賬或回滾腳本并記錄變更;C. 修復(fù)致因(重啟消費者、修補解析邏輯、調(diào)整緩存策略);D. 監(jiān)控與告警回歸并進行事后復(fù)盤。

6) 技術(shù)創(chuàng)新建議:引入可驗證流水(Merkle proofs)、零知識審計用于隱私合規(guī),采用云原生彈性部署與自動化對賬機器人,利用智能化數(shù)據(jù)管理實現(xiàn)近實時一致性。
結(jié)語:將上述診斷步驟標準化為SOP并結(jié)合安全設(shè)計,可把tpwallet“顯示為零”的突發(fā)事件,轉(zhuǎn)變?yōu)榭勺匪?、可恢?fù)、并可持續(xù)優(yōu)化的工程能力。
作者:林亦辰發(fā)布時間:2026-01-03 03:42:52